How Can Sustainable Management Practices Ensure the Longevity of Our Natural Resources?

Sustainable management practices are really important for keeping our natural resources healthy for a long time. These practices help us use resources wisely while also taking care of the environment. Let's break down some key points about this topic:

  1. Looking at Our Resources: Sustainable management begins by checking how much natural resources we have. For instance, forests cover about 31% of the Earth’s land. We can use sustainable practices to keep these forests intact and reduce deforestation, which is when trees are cut down. From 2015 to 2020, around 10 million hectares of forest were lost each year.

  2. Ways to Protect Resources:

    • Managing Renewable Resources: It’s essential to take care of renewable resources like fish. If we manage fish populations properly, we can avoid catching too many. Right now, about 34% of fish are overfished, so we need better fishing methods.
    • Water Management: Only about 2.5% of the Earth's water is fresh and usable. By using smart watering techniques, we can improve how we use water by as much as 60%.
  3. Restoring Damaged Ecosystems: Sustainable management also means working to fix damaged areas in nature. The United Nations says that if we restore 350 million hectares of land, it could capture about $1.4 trillion in carbon and help the environment.

  4. Getting Communities Involved: It's crucial to include local communities in managing resources. Research shows that when communities lead these efforts, it can reduce deforestation rates by up to 33% compared to other methods.

By using these strategies, sustainable management practices help us use natural resources wisely. This keeps our ecosystems in balance and ensures that future generations can enjoy a clean and healthy environment.
